Hoi and BluSmart collaborate to streamline airport travel with in-cab services

Hoi, a travel-tech platform focused on enhancing airport experiences, has announced a partnership with BluSmart, South Asia’s all-electric ride-hailing service. The collaboration aims to improve airport travel by integrating Hoi’s airport services into BluSmart rides, targeting 2.5 lakh cab rides across Delhi-NCR over a one-month campaign.

This partnership introduces several features to improve passenger convenience. Riders traveling to airports in BluSmart cabs will have the option to pre-order airport meals, enabling them to avoid queues at food counters and proceed directly to their boarding gates. Hoi’s integration with the Airport Flight Status Display System and the Airport Operations Database (AODB) provides real-time updates on flight schedules and gate information.

Passengers can access these services through in-cab displays or directly via the Hoi platform. BluSmart riders will also receive exclusive offers on Hoi’s services, accessible through the Hoi app or the BluSmart app. These features aim to simplify the journey for airport-bound travelers while promoting the use of sustainable transportation.

Harshvardhan Singh, Chief Operating Officer of Hoi, stated that the partnership represents a step towards creating a more efficient travel experience by integrating smart airport services with sustainable transportation. He highlighted the convenience of managing airport-related tasks during the cab ride, further enhancing the travel process.

Hoi’s platform, currently active at airports in Delhi, Hyderabad, and New Goa (GOX), offers a range of services. These include pre-ordering food and beverages, concierge support such as lounge access and porter services, priority check-ins, and AI-based assistance for airport-related queries. The platform also centralizes essential travel information through its Info Center. Future plans include introducing duty-free pre-ordering and a loyalty program.
